According to the limitation page "this edition of Francisco de Goya's 'Disasters of War' has been reproduced from the album of proof impressions assembled by the artist for Juan Agustín Ceán Bermúdez now held in the British Museum." Previous reproductions have consisted of 82 illustrations but this one has all 85 along with commentary by Mark McDonald former Curator in Department of Prints and Drawings at the British Museum and now with the Metropolitan Museum of Art in New York. According to McDonald Goya's 'Disasters of Wars' is öne of the most remarkable representations of conflict where Goya addresses the reasons for war and explores its consequences." 1370362. 192249586Paris: Chez l'Auteur 1922. Near fine. First edition of Delteil's two-part fully illustrated catalogue raisonnée of Goya's etchings and engravings bound in a single volume. 12.25'' x 9.5''. Later beige cloth with gilt-lettered black morocco spine label. Original paper wrappers bound in. Printed by Frazier-Soye. 289 black and white plates by Goya with 3 additional plates of doubtful attribution. Text in French. Minimal wear to cloth.
